Ride starts at Alice&#39;s Restaurant and ends at Phil&#39;s Fish Market in Moss Landing for lunch.<br /><br />Map of route: https://goo.gl/maps/PXHsLbK4FYLAZjidA<br /><br />The following are some basic group ride protocols for anyone:<br /><br />Be ready to leave on time. Show up with your tank full, your tires checked, with proper clothing and a bike which is safe to ride. Don&#39;t hold up your fellow riders because you did not prepare for the ride properly. Also, be prepared to help your fellow riders with any problems on the road.<br /><br />Safe speed: The safe speed for road conditions will differ from rider to rider. You are responsible to pick a pace that is comfortable and within your ability. There will be plenty of opportunities to regroup. Do not ride beyond your limits in an attempt to keep up with other riders!<br /><br />Do not follow too closely! Ride in staggered files on the freeway, and leave a safe distance between you and the next rider. It is very important to avoid following too closely on the secondary roads.<br />Passing: If you are prepared to ride faster than the rider in front, put your blinker on and pass. If you see a rider behind you preparing to pass, move over, and give plenty of room.<br /><br />Stopping: If the group stops, be sure to pull off the road completely. When the group starts, be sure to look over your shoulder for approaching traffic before you pull out to follow the person in front of you.<br /><br />Breakdowns: The sweep riders and riding friends may stop and provide assistance. It is not safe for then entire group to stop for one rider.<br /><br />Taking off early: There are plenty of opportunities to take bail-out routes and head home early. It is appreciated if you let the ride leader, others in the group, or sweeps know that you are planning to take off early so we don&#39;t wait around and go looking for you.
